In a rather interesting turn of events, 21-time grand slam champion Rafael Nadal suffered a shocking defeat in the hands of Canadian southpaw Denis Shapovalov in the Round of 16 of the Rome Masters. Nadal lost the match in three sets 6-1,5-7,6-2 and ended his quest to a record 11th title at Foro Italico.

Nadal looked in charge of the match after the first set and many believed that he’d wrap things up comfortably but to his dismay, Nadal started feeling discomfort in his left foot towards the end of the second set which he eventually lost 5-7. The 35-year-old tried to regroup in the third set and stayed in serve till the 5th game when things started getting worse. The pain was visible on his face as he couldn’t move much and at times limped on the court. He lost 17 out of the last 20 points and lost the set 2-6.

The last few minutes of the match were very tough to watch for almost anyone. It was hard to see a legend of the sport struggling on a surface he has owned basically all his life. Nadal has a chronic foot problem which means that his foot will never be 100% okay. The pain might kick in at any point and that’s what happened in Rome on Thursday.
